In-Suk Hamm is a scholar working on Neurology, Surgery and Cellular and Molecular Neuroscience. According to data from OpenAlex, In-Suk Hamm has authored 21 papers receiving a total of 444 indexed citations (citations by other indexed papers that have themselves been cited), including 13 papers in Neurology, 9 papers in Surgery and 5 papers in Cellular and Molecular Neuroscience. Recurrent topics in In-Suk Hamm's work include Neurosurgical Procedures and Complications (9 papers), Intracranial Aneurysms: Treatment and Complications (7 papers) and Cerebrospinal fluid and hydrocephalus (4 papers). In-Suk Hamm is often cited by papers focused on Neurosurgical Procedures and Complications (9 papers), Intracranial Aneurysms: Treatment and Complications (7 papers) and Cerebrospinal fluid and hydrocephalus (4 papers). In-Suk Hamm collaborates with scholars based in South Korea. In-Suk Hamm's co-authors include Jaechan Park, Seong‐Hyun Park, Jeong-Hyun Hwang, Sung-Kyoo Hwang, Sun‐Ho Lee, Dong-Hun Kang, Yong‐Sun Kim, Donghun Kang, Jae-Suk Park and Dong‐Hun Kang and has published in prestigious journals such as Journal of neurosurgery, Neurosurgery and Acta Neurochirurgica.
